Evaluation of the Adhesive Bonding Processes Used in Helicopter Manufacture. Part I. Durability of Adhesive Bonds Obtained as a Result of Processes Used in the UH-1Helicopter.

摘要

The methods used to prepare adherends for components of UH-1aircraft (prior to bonding) were evaluated for their effect upon the durability of the bonded joint. The phosphate-fluoride method for titanium produces a surface which,when bonded,was 7.5to 10times more durable than joints prepared from titanium surfaces that were alkaline cleaned. Upon aging,the surface structure of the phosphate-fluoride treated specimens showed signs of conversion to the less durable structure found on the alkaline-cleaned titanium. The method used to anodize aluminum produced a surface which,when bonded,exhibited essentially the same durability as the bonds using phosphate-fluoride-etched titanium. Bonds to glass-resin-composite adherends are as durable as the composite itself and failures were found to be interlaminar. (Author)
